This prospective, single-center, parallel-group, assessor-blinded randomized controlled trial will include 120 voluntary male participants who have had complaints of urinary frequency for at least 3 months and meet the inclusion criteria. Participants will be randomly allocated into two groups (Group 1: Bladder Training + Pelvic Floor Muscle Training; Group 2: Bladder Training Alone). Assessments will be repeated at baseline, at week 4, and at week 8. The primary outcome measure will be 3-day bladder diary data (24-hour voiding frequency); secondary outcomes will include the OAB-V8, ICIQ-OAB, and PGI-I scales, as well as transabdominal ultrasonographic measurements of bladder neck elevation (strength and endurance) and PVR.
